Transaction 668752a40beab40e322fcbac944c55554884c049cd36deadbe04378a76502561
1 Input
1 Output
-
668752a40beab40e322fcbac944c55554884c049cd36deadbe04378a76502561:0
- value
- 3886127
- script pubkey
- OP_0 OP_PUSHBYTES_20 b73bfaa3c835191f903ce40a7dc29bd003e770f9
- address
- bc1qkual4g7gx5v3lypuus98ms5m6qp7wu8ejycn3p